The Foxglove Community Gardens is a pleasant approach to offering the community an opportunity to participate in a common project, bringing young people from the surrounding schools, apartment and city dwellers who no longer have access to a garden, and Seniors, together in a meaningful activity.

The project offers the opportunity for graduating highschool students to acquire their community service requirements. Students from the Chemainus High School are already involved in designing and manufacturing the formal FOXGLOVE sign and producing garden ornaments and birdhouse collections.

We also offer cooking classes lead by well known cookbook authors and experts in cuisine.


New Horizons for Seniors Program, Capital Assistance Funding Program funded our kitchen remolding project in the amount of $10,635. Foxglove Community Gardens started the culinary school two years ago. It seemed a natural fit to have a cooking school combine with the community gardens. We now offer intercultural cooking classes and it has sinse become the prime source of income to maintain the gardens.

The cooking classes have also become a social meeting place. Our school was in dire need of upgrading and if we didn't receive this funding our cooking school was going to close. The money will be used to add new counter tops, flooring and plumbing.
